반응형 Python2720 pandas ValueError: No axis named x in object 오류 해결하기 소개Pandas 라이브러리를 사용하다 보면 'ValueError: No axis named x in object'라는 에러를 자주 마주칠 수 있습니다. 이 오류는 데이터프레임 또는 시리즈에서 특정 축(axes)을 지정할 때 그 축이 존재하지 않는 경우 발생하게 됩니다. 이번 블로그 포스트에서는 이 오류의 원인과 일반적인 해결 방법에 대해 알아보겠습니다.에러 발생 예시 코드먼저, 'ValueError: No axis named x in object' 에러가 발생할 수 있는 예시 코드를 한 번 살펴보겠습니다.import pandas as pd# 간단한 데이터프레임 생성data = {'A': [1, 2, 3], 'B': [4, 5, 6]}df = pd.DataFrame(data)# 존재하지 않는 축 'x'에서.. 2025. 5. 1. selenium.switch_to.alert로 경고창 처리하기 Selenium의 switch_to.alert로 웹사이트 경고창 처리하기웹 자동화는 현대 개발자들에게 필수적인 도구로 자리잡고 있습니다. 그 중에서도 Selenium 라이브러리는 브라우저 상호작용을 통해 다양한 작업을 자동화하는 데 큰 도움을 줍니다. 특히, switch_to.alert 메소드는 웹 페이지에서 발생하는 경고창(alert)을 효과적으로 처리할 수 있는 방법 중 하나입니다. 이번 포스팅에서는 경고창을 처리하는 방법을 자세히 설명하고, 예제 코드를 통해 실습해보겠습니다.selenium.switch_to.alert 메소드 소개switch_to.alert 메소드는 현재 열린 브라우저에서 표시된 경고창과 상호작용을 할 수 있도록 해주는 Selenium의 기능입니다. 이는 웹 페이지에서 중요한 사용자.. 2025. 5. 1. 드롭다운 선택하기: selenium.select_from_dropdown 활용법 Selenium의 select_from_dropdown 함수: 드롭다운에서 원하는 옵션 선택하기웹 자동화의 세계에서 특별한 도구인 Selenium은 웹 페이지의 다양한 요소와의 상호작용을 가능하게 합니다. 그 중에서도 select_from_dropdown 함수는 드롭다운 목록에서 원하는 항목을 쉽게 선택할 수 있는 강력한 기능을 제공합니다. 이 포스팅에서는 select_from_dropdown의 사용법과 실제 예제를 통해 그 활용성을 살펴보겠습니다.select_from_dropdown 함수 소개select_from_dropdown 함수는 HTML의 `` 태그로 구현된 드롭다운에서 특정 옵션을 선택할 수 있도록 도와줍니다. 사용자에게 제공되는 여러 선택지 중에서 원하는 항목을 선택하는 과정은 종종 자동화된.. 2025. 5. 1. pandas ValueError: Length of index does not match length of data 오류 해결하기 소개데이터를 처리할 때 판다스(Pandas)를 사용하는 것은 매우 유용하지만, 때때로 기술적인 문제에 직면하게 됩니다. 특히, 'ValueError: Length of index does not match length of data' 오류는 인덱스와 데이터 길이가 맞지 않을 때 발생하는 일반적인 오류입니다. 이 글에서는 이 오류의 발생 원인과 해결 방법을 살펴보겠습니다.에러 발생 예시 코드아래는 'ValueError: Length of index does not match length of data' 에러가 발생할 수 있는 간단한 예시 코드입니다.import pandas as pd# 데이터와 인덱스의 길이가 일치하지 않음data = [1, 2, 3]index = ['a', 'b']# 데이터프레임 생성df.. 2025. 4. 30. pandas ValueError: Failed to parse a datetime string 오류 해결하기 소개파이썬의 Pandas 라이브러리를 사용할 때 종종 'ValueError: Failed to parse a datetime string' 오류가 발생할 수 있습니다. 이 오류는 Pandas가 날짜 및 시간 문자열을 해석할 수 없을 때 발생합니다. 이 포스트에서는 이 에러가 발생하는 원인과 그것을 효과적으로 해결할 수 있는 방법들에 대해 알아보도록 하겠습니다.에러 발생 예시 코드먼저, 'ValueError: Failed to parse a datetime string' 에러가 발생할 수 있는 간단한 예시 코드를 살펴보겠습니다.import pandas as pd# 날짜 문자열 리스트date_strings = ["2020-01-01", "2020-02-30", "March 10, 2020", "invalid.. 2025. 4. 30. 페이지 하단으로 스크롤하기: selenium.scroll_to_bottom 함수 Selenium의 scroll_to_bottom 함수: 페이지 하단으로 부드럽게 스크롤하기웹 스크래핑이나 자동화 테스트를 수행할 때, 페이지의 하단에 있는 요소를 찾아야 할 경우가 많습니다. 이때 Selenium의 scroll_to_bottom 함수를 활용하면, 페이지 하단으로 부드럽게 스크롤하면서 필요한 정보를 쉽게 찾을 수 있습니다. 이번 포스팅에서는 scroll_to_bottom 함수의 사용법과 예제를 소개하겠습니다.scroll_to_bottom 함수 소개scroll_to_bottom 함수는 현재 브라우저의 뷰포트를 페이지의 맨 아래로 이동시켜, 하단에 숨겨져 있는 요소들까지 쉽게 접근할 수 있도록 해줍니다. 이 방법은 긴 스크롤 페이지나 AJAX로 내용을 로드하는 페이지에서 특히 유용합니다.함수 .. 2025. 4. 30. 이전 1 ··· 93 94 95 96 97 98 99 ··· 454 다음 반응형